Built by Aaron Keim before he joined forces with Mya Moe, this little lovely is one he built for his wife.

It's stained a beautiful red from it's handbuilt maple body to the birdseye maple neck. Ebony fretboard and ebony peghead. Has a goat skin head that Aaron put on for me. Incredibly low action - I actually had to put a higher saddle in to make it easier for my beginning fingers to play!

One thing that makes the ORIGINAL Beansprout Banjos (as opposed to the ones he makes for Mya Moe) special is that Aaron designed the head so that the frame holding the skin doesn't screw through the body of the uke. It also has a flat fretboard and geared banjo tuners.
